Job Responsibilities

  • Work directly with the business to co-create a detailed vision of the tools they need to effectively monitor the dark-web and other data sources tohelp their company and their clients from threats.

  • Define a set of metrics reports and alerts that support the vision and are technically feasible given the available data and modelling resources.

  • The business objectives of each metric and report need to be clearly defined along with the specification of how the metric should be calculated from existing data.

  • The business stakeholders will only be able to provide high-level goals.

  • It will be the responsibility of this role to provide an industry best practice view of what analytics are needed and how they should be constructed.

  • This role must play the dual responsibilities of SME and architect.

  • This role requires getting the perspective of a chief risk officer to design an analytics package that identifies the most critical threats.

  • Additionally, the role demands clearly articulating this package in both business language and technical specifications as well as guiding engineering resources in its development and delivery.

Required Skills

  • Principles of cyber security and risk management.

  • Strong working knowledge of metrics commonly used in cyber security and fraud analytics.

  • Familiarity with dark web intelligence tools techniques and sources.

  • Familiarity with the tactics techniques and procedures used by cybercriminals hackers and other threat actors who operate on the dark web.

  • Knowledge of the specific cybersecurity requirements and regulatory standards that apply to financial institutions and cloud engineering and the construction of data preparation and analytics pipelines.

Capgemini is a global business and technology transformation partner, helping organizations to accelerate their dual transition to a digital and sustainable world, while creating tangible impact for enterprises and society. It is a responsible and diverse group of 340,000 team members in more than 50 countries. With its strong over 55-year heritage, Capgemini is trusted by its clients to unlock the value of technology to address the entire breadth of their business needs. It delivers end-to-end services and solutions leveraging strengths from strategy and design to engineering, all fuelled by its market leading capabilities in AI, cloud and data, combined with its deep industry expertise and partner ecosystem. The Group reported 2023 global revenues of €22.5 billion.
